Shouhuo Farm is a Manufacturer located in Zhanjiang, Guangdong Province. It is one of the 56301 manufacturers in China. Address of Shouhuo Farm is Leizhou, Zhanjiang, Guangdong Province, China.
Some of the places around Shouhuo Farm are -
Leizhou, Zhanjiang, Guangdong Province, China
Address of Shouhuo Farm is Leizhou, Zhanjiang, Guangdong Province, China.
Shouhuo Farm is located in Zhanjiang, Guangdong Province.
Shouhuo Farm is a Manufacturer in China